Tony Frank(1943-2000)

  • Actor
  • Additional Crew
IMDbProStarmeterSee rank
Tony Frank in Rush (1991)
Tony Frank was born on 9 December 1943 in Nacogdoches, Texas, USA. He was an actor, known for Young Guns II (1990), Lone Star (1996) and Born on the Fourth of July (1989). He was married to Katherine Swango. He died on 18 April 2000 in Houston, Texas, USA.

Did you know

Edit
  • Trivia
    Played Salem Jones in "North and South" and "North and South: Book II," but then played a different character named Keyes in "North and South: Book III."
